London Man Becomes The Second Person To Be Cured Of HIV

For the second time in our doctors managed to cure a man that was diagnosed with HIV. This is the second time a person has been cured since the outbreak happened.

The unidentified received the stem cell therapy 3 years ago from an HIV resistant donor, he later on, went to continue his medication that will prevent the disease to grow inside his body, this treatment is called ART, which stands for Antiretroviral Treatment.

After going through highly sensitive tests and screenings, his body showed no signs of HIV present in his system.

Ravindra Gupta, the HIV biologist who co-led a team of doctors while treating the unidentified man, said that it is still too early to say that he has been cured of the disease, but he did say that he has been “Functionally Cured” and is currently “In Remission”.

The patient got the disease in 2003 and in 2012 the patient was also diagnosed with Hodgkin Lymphoma.

In 2016, the patient got the stem cell transplant as he was going through the treatment for cancer and not for HIV. The doctors have not said anything about why the patient did not start with the Antiretroviral Treatment when he got diagnosed with HIV.

The donor who played a huge hand in the cure had a genetic mutation that is known as CCR5 Delta 32, a gene that is providing resistance against HIV.

Head of the HIV/AIDS division in the National Institutes of Health, Dr. Anthony Fauci said that this is not the type of treatment that is applicable to everyone, and to those people who are diagnosed with the disease should not expect this type of treatment to become a stock standard for those who want to get cured of the disease.

Dr. Anthony Fauci said: “If I have Hodgkin’s disease or myeloid leukemia,” he said, “that’s going to kill me anyway, and I need to have a stem cell transplant, and I also happen to have HIV, then this is very interesting. But this is not applicable to the millions of people who don’t need a stem cell transplant.”

Timothy Ray Brown the first man known to be cured of HIV

The unidentified patient has now joined Timothy Ray Brown, the only person that is known to be cured of HIV, he is also known as the Berlin Patient.

Timothy Ray Brown was diagnosed with HIV in 1995 and immediately started the Antiretroviral Treatment. Timothy Ray was also diagnosed with acute myeloid leukemia and also received a stem cell transplant from a donor who had the same CCR5 Delta 32 Gene.

Just after 3 months of his first treatment, HIV in his body started to drop dramatically and was listed undetectable after some time.

Timothy Ray Brown does not take any treatment now, usually, people who are diagnosed with HIV are advised to continue the Antiretroviral Treatment.

The second cure for the disease may not unlock the real cure to the disease that has killed over millions of people throughout the years, but this gives hope to those researchers who are constantly trying to find a cure for the disease as it may be possible to cure them in some circumstances like this one.
